Street trees are located in the public right-of-way between the curb and sidewalk.The City’s Public Works Department is responsible for removing and pruning street trees. It is unlawful for a resident to prune or remove a street tree.
Submit a service request to prune or remove a City street tree via the MyMilpitas App or calling (408) 586-2600.

Milpitas residents have a number of FREE options to dispose of bulky items:
- Bulky Item Pick-Ups: Single-family residential customers in Milpitas are entitled up to 4 free bulky item/clean ups in a rolling 12-month period (must be scheduled at least 8 weeks apart).
- Zanker Voucher: Contact the City of Milpitas at (408) 586-3341 or MilpitasRecycles@milpitas.gov to request a voucher that allows you to dispose of accepted bulky items at the Zanker Material Processing Facility at 675 Los Esteros Road in San Jose.
- Neighborhood Clean-Ups: Contact the City of Milpitas by calling (408) 586-3341, e-mailing MilpitasRecycles@milpitas.gov, or visiting our Large Item Pick-up & Clean-ups page to find out when and where upcoming neighborhood clean-ups will occur. Register for the clean-up date that works best for you.
For details and information on all of the bulky item disposal options, visit Milpitas Sanitation's Bulky Item and On Call Clean-up Program page.
Paid options include:
- For large item removal projects, you can rent a debris bin and schedule a pick-up from Milpitas Sanitation.
- Multi-family residential complexes can arrange for a bulky item pick-up/clean up for a fee. All fees must be prepaid. For more information, visit: Milpitas Sanitation's Multi-Family Bulky Item and On Call Clean-up Program page.

Schedule an appointment or find a drop off location for household hazardous waste at Santa Clara County's Household Hazardous Waste website.
If you live in a single-family home in Milpitas, you are eligible for free curbside pick up of batteries, used motor oil/oil filters, and used cooking oil:
- Battery Collection: Place household batteries inside a clear plastic zipper-lock style bag (no car batteries allowed). Please tape the terminals on lithium and 9-volt batteries. Place the bag on top of (not inside) your Blue Recyclables Split Cart for collection.
- Used Motor Oil and Filters: Contain used oil in a sealed 1-gallon, screw-top container* and filters in a sealed zipper-lock style bag*. Place next to (not inside) your blue recyclables split cart for collection.
- Used Cooking Oil: Contain used cooking oil in a sealed 1-gallon, screw-top container*. Place next to (not inside) your blue recyclables split cart for collection.
*Free screw-top containers/bags provided by Milpitas Sanitation. Call to request at (408) 988-4500.
